Badriya Talba Referred for Immediate Investigation Over Inappropriate Language Towards Followers Badriya Talba: "The Circulated Videos Are Edited"

The Board of the Egyptian Actors’ Syndicate, chaired by Dr. Ashraf Zaki, unanimously decided to refer actress Badriya Talba to an immediate investigation following her recent videos, in which she responded to some followers with words and hints deemed by the syndicate inappropriate for an Egyptian actress toward her audience.

The board referred Badriya to the investigation while emphasizing that all legal measures would be taken against any artist who violates the syndicate’s code of ethical conduct.

Badriya Talba Responds to the Syndicate’s Decision In response, Badriya Talba issued a statement expressing deep regret for her recent actions, affirming her full respect for the syndicate and her confidence in the fairness of the forthcoming investigation.

She said, "I am at the service of my syndicate because I indeed erred when I got carried away by a small group that does not represent the Egyptian people, giving them a chance to exploit my videos and use them against me." She added that she tried to offer a sincere apology to her audience, whom she respects and values, but made another mistake when the apology came across as tense due to what she described as "continuous provocation from some people," noting, "I should have been calmer, and surely those who love me will understand."

“Edited Videos” Badriya emphasized that her audience is the real reason for her success and that no offense can be directed at them. She also pointed out that the circulating videos were edited and that full versions are available on her official page.

She concluded by affirming her welcome of the investigation within the syndicate, considering it an opportunity to prove the truth of what happened, away from tension or attempts at provocation.
